Four Hot Cocoa Mix Packets: Typically, the packets have about 1.38 ounces every, so you will have 2/three cups of the combination, or 5 1/2 ounces.<br><br><br><br>Don't use the packets that embrace mini marshmallows. From your Pantry: Granulated sugar, brown sugar, [https://wiki.voice-technology.nl/index.php/User:BritneyBriones Wood Ranger Power Shears website] pure vanilla extract, all function flour, baking soda, baking powder, table salt, and semi-sweet chocolate chips. From the Fridge: Unsalted butter, slightly softened, and eggs. Marshmallows: You have to about 18 massive marshmallows, cut in half. First, you whisk together the the new cocoa packets, the flour, baking soda, baking powder, and salt. Next, you cream collectively the butter and sugars till creamy and pale. Then, you beat in the eggs and vanilla and beat the mixture until it's fluffy. After that, mix in half of the flour mixture till simply mixed. Then, gently combine in the rest of the dry substances on low until simply blended. You then totally chill the dough, not less than two hours. When the dough is chilled, form it into 1 1/2 tablespoon balls and bake them on a parchment-lined baking sheet, one sheet at a time. You will place 1/2 of a marshmallow on top each cookie after about 9 minutes of baking.<br><br><br><br>Continue baking for an additional five minutes. Finally, when the cookies have cooled, unfold some of the melted chocolate chips over the marshmallow and let cool. Make sure to let some of the marshmallow peek by way of. These cookies might tend to unfold out and be too flat. To prevent this, be sure that your oven is totally preheated and that you bake the cookies one baking sheet at a time. In addition, when you are baking the cookies, keep the rest of the dough balls in the fridge or freezer so that they remain chilled. It is also useful to use a scale to measure the flour (and test on the burden of the new cocoa packets in case the brand has shrunk the volume of their mix). To unfold the melted chocolate over the marshmallow, drop a tablespoon on high after which swirl it with a spoon.
